Transaction 15b74914ae2f75bba2b5b7625f5cadf279c2cc8243d28955fce2e5bbd991f619

8 Input
2 Outputs
  • 15b74914ae2f75bba2b5b7625f5cadf279c2cc8243d28955fce2e5bbd991f619:0
  • value  2434062170
    address  3JcWcMPtxGaCuhKeucTMe1V865t7UhrNnT
  • 15b74914ae2f75bba2b5b7625f5cadf279c2cc8243d28955fce2e5bbd991f619:1
  • value  4080957
    address  35iMHbUZeTssxBodiHwEEkb32jpBfVueEL